Transaction 7d6621fe2cafeafbcea22284186c5451247a2c282035f0eaf7a633a801d70102
1 Input
1 Output
-
7d6621fe2cafeafbcea22284186c5451247a2c282035f0eaf7a633a801d70102:0
- value
- 29371
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7f614e03a54f9223f8437898fcaada4d35688640 OP_EQUAL
- address
- 3DJYJkwACXbCx32bzwUvhSevgopaxzAzNA